§ 58-11-55 Discrimination in issuance or renewal of automobile insurance policy as misdemeanor--Exceptions.

58-11-55. Discrimination in issuance or renewal of automobile insurance policy as misdemeanor--Exceptions. Except as provided in §§ 58-11-55.1 and 58-11-55.2, no insurer may refuse to issue or to renew a policy or certificate solely because of the age, residence, race, color, creed, national origin, ancestry, occupation, or marital status of the applicant or the insured. Violation of this section is a Class 2 misdemeanor. Nothing in this section requires an insurer to issue or renew a policy or certificate to a person who is not a resident of this state.

Source: SL 1968, ch 138, § 9 as added by SL 1969, ch 139; SL 1978, ch 359, § 2; SL 1997, ch 287, § 1; SL 2002, ch 235, § 2.
